[QUOTE="Nehanda, post: 27171, member: 2262"] MSI just released its new graphics cards based on NVIDIA GeForce RTX 5070 GPUs. They focus on how well these cards perform and handle heat. The lineup includes different models called Gaming Trio, Ventus, Inspire, and Vanguard. Each one has special cooling systems like three-fan setups, vapor chambers, and smart airflow designs. These features keep the cards cool even during heavy use. These cards run on NVIDIA's Blackwell technology, which makes them better at gaming, AI work, and creating content. Every model serves a different purpose. The Vanguard works great for tasks that need lots of computing power. It uses a vapor chamber and special fan blades to move heat away fast. The Gaming Trio has three fans plus a nickel-plated copper base that cools things down quickly. The Ventus fits into smaller computers thanks to its compact design. It uses something called TORX Fan 5.0 that keeps performance steady even when space gets tight. The Inspire helps with basic AI tasks. It has a small size and modern look that combines good function with a nice appearance. The Vanguard stands as MSI's newest top-level card for gamers who want the best performance and futuristic style. It comes with HYPER FROZR cooling that includes STORMFORCE fans with special claw-textured blades for better air movement. It also has Vapor Chamber technology that moves heat away super fast, plus Core Pipes that spread out the heat. The card has an Airflow Control system with Wave Curved 4.0 and Air Antegrade Fin 2.0 designs. These improve cooling and cut down on noisy air. The card looks like a spaceship and has RGB lights that change colors. MSI celebrates the launch with the Lucky Blind Box. This limited edition package contains one of ten exclusive Lucky designs. Some boxes even have a rare secret version. This adds a fun surprise when you open up your new graphics card. The GAMING TRIO connects to MSI's Dragon Spirit history. These cards give steady performance with a sleek design made for both gamers and creators. They use TRIO FROZR 4 cooling with STORMFORCE Fans and a nickel-plated copper base. The cards also feature Wave Curved 4.0 and Air Antegrade Fin 2.0 technology that helps air flow better. This makes them run cool and quiet. They come with colorful RGB lighting and MSI's dragon logo for both power and style. Besides the regular black version, MSI offers a white edition for people who prefer that clean, modern look. VENTUS cards balance performance and value, making them reliable choices for gamers. They feature a design that seems futuristic but remains practical above all else. They use TORX Fan 5.0 technology that pushes air around better. A metal backplate makes them more durable. The RTX 5070 VENTUS cards follow the SFF-Ready Enthusiast GeForce Card size rules. This means they work with many Mini-ITX and microATX cases, perfect for small but powerful computer builds. You can choose between regular dual-fan models or white dual-fan versions, depending on what fits your setup better. The INSPIRE graphics card delivers entry-level AI performance packed into a small, attractive package. Its design takes inspiration from Mondrian art, mixing modern art ideas with technology. This helps it blend perfectly into creative and professional workspaces. The card uses a STORMFORCE FAN and nickel-plated copper base. These parts keep it cool and running smoothly. Like the VENTUS, it meets SFF-Ready Enthusiast GeForce Card size guidelines. This makes it ideal for systems that need high performance but have limited space. [/QUOTE]
